Galatasaray's Belgian star footballer Dries Mertens and his wife Katrin Kerkhofs are expecting their second child. It has been reported that the couple, who will have a baby girl, has decided to give their baby a Turkish name due to their love for Istanbul.
Dries Mertens, the Belgian former national football player who transferred from Napoli to Galatasaray and has been wearing the yellow-red jersey for 3 seasons, and his wife Katrin Kerkhofs, are experiencing a sweet excitement. Mertens and his wife Kerkhofs, who have a son named Ciro Romeo, are currently expecting their second child.
THEY WILL CHOOSE A TURKISH NAME
In this regard, the star of Galatasaray has made a surprising decision with his wife to give a Turkish name to their daughter, as he will experience the feeling of fatherhood for the second time. It has been stated that the Belgian couple made this decision due to their love for Istanbul, and the name they will give to their baby has become a great curiosity among football fans.
GALATASARAY CAREER
Mertens has played 132 matches for Galatasaray, scoring 24 goals and providing 44 assists. The contract of the 37-year-old star will expire at the end of the season.
